Community Responses: The Good, The Bad, and The Uncertain

The comment section became a delightful tapestry of responses, laying out the depth of thoughts and sentiments players have regarding this odd rock. For instance, user CreamOfPotatoSoup provided a whimsical yet informative insight, linking the mysterious rock to so-called ‘Error Cubes.’ They humorously chimed in, stating these cubes do nothing except “give you XP and collect dust in the cosmetic terminal.” It’s comments like these that emphasize the playful nature of the Deep Rock Galactic community, turning revelations about in-game resources into lighthearted banter while simultaneously educating newer players about the quirky in-game items. It goes to show how the community thrives on combining humor with a bit of lore!
